Bethany Nelson is the woman behind Milkhaus Design, a line of home and fashion accessories she started two summers ago after taking a bunch of design classes and deciding that she should do what she loved: create beautiful, modern things.

Nelson is inspired by simple images, such as a crack in a sidewalk or a doodle she makes during a meeting, and she creates practical items that buck trends. She has made the perfect line of tea towels (doing everything from dying to sewing herself) and is going to be expanding her home line into storage buckets and pillows soon.

Based in Madison, Wisconsin, Nelson is often in Chicago for events and her line is carried at Neighborly in Ravenswood and Evelyn Jane in Downers Grove, as well as on her Etsy page.
